What can be done about mass unemployment? All the wise heads agree: there are no quick or easy answers. There's work to be done, but workers aren't ready to do it—they're in the wrong places, or they have the wrong skills. Our problems are "structural," and will take many years to solve.
关于大规模失业,我们能做些什么?所有智者都认为:没有快速或简单的答案。有工作要做,但工人们没有准备好去做——他们要么在错误的地方,要么拥有错误的技能。我们的问题是“结构性的”,需要很多年才能解决。
But don't bother asking for evidence that justifies this bleak view. There isn't any. On the contrary, all the facts suggest that high unemployment in America is the result of inadequate demand. Saying that there're no easy answers sounds wise, but it's actually foolish: our unemployment crisis could be cured very quickly if we had the intellectual clarity and political will to act. In other words, structural unemployment is a fake problem, which mainly serves as an excuse for not pursuing real solutions.
但不必费心去寻找证据来证明这种悲观观点。实际上没有证据。相反,所有事实表明,美国的高失业率是需求不足的结果。说没有简单答案听起来很明智,但实际上很愚蠢:如果我们有清醒的智力和政治意愿去行动,失业危机可以很快得到解决。换句话说,结构性失业是一个假问题,主要用作不追求真正解决方案的借口。
The fact is job openings have plunged in every major sector, while the number of workers forced into part-time employment in almost all industries has soared. Unemployment has surged in every major occupational category. Only three states, with a combined population not much larger than that of Brooklyn, have unemployment rates below 5%. So the evidence contradicts the claim that we're mainly suffering from structural unemployment. Why, then, has this claim become so popular?
事实是,每个主要行业的职位空缺都急剧下降,而几乎所有行业中被迫从事兼职工作的工人数却激增。失业率在每个主要职业类别中都飙升。只有三个州,其总人口不比布鲁克林大多少,失业率低于5%。因此,证据与我们主要遭受结构性失业的主张相矛盾。那么,为什么这一主张变得如此流行?
Part of the answer is that this is what always happens during periods of high unemployment-in part because experts and analysts believe that declaring the problem deeply rooted, with no easy answers, makes them sound serious.
部分答案是,这总是在高失业率时期发生的——部分原因是专家和分析师认为,宣布问题根深蒂固、没有简单答案,会让他们听起来很严肃。
I've been looking at what self-proclaimed experts were saying about unemployment during the Great Depression; it was almost identical to what Very Serious People are saying now. Unemployment cannot be brought down rapidly, declared one 1935 analysis, because the workforce is "unadaptable and untrained. It cannot respond to the opportunities which industry may offer." A few years later, a large defense buildup finally provided a fiscal stimulus adequate to the economy's needs—and suddenly industry was eager to employ those "unadaptable and untrained" workers.
我一直在研究大萧条期间自封的专家们关于失业的说法;这与现在“非常严肃的人”所说的几乎一模一样。1935年的一项分析宣称,失业率不能迅速下降,因为劳动力“无法适应且未经训练。它无法应对工业可能提供的机会。”几年后,大规模的国防建设终于提供了足够的财政刺激来满足经济需求——突然间,工业界渴望雇佣那些“无法适应且未经训练”的工人。
But now, as then, powerful forces are ideologically opposed to the whole idea of government action on a sufficient scale to jump-start the economy. And that, fundamentally, is why claims that we face huge structural problems have-been multiplying: they offer a reason to do nothing about the mass unemployment that is crippling our economy and our society.
但如今,就像过去一样,强大的势力在意识形态上反对政府采取足够规模的行动来启动经济。根本上,这就是为什么我们面临巨大结构性问题的主张越来越多:它们为对正在削弱我们经济和社会的大规模失业无所作为提供了理由。
So what you need to know is that there's no evidence whatsoever to back these claims. We aren't suffering from a shortage of needed skills; we're suffering from a lack of policy resolve. As I said, structural unemployment isn't a real problem, it's an excuse -- a reason not to act on America's problems at a time when action is desperately needed.
所以你需要知道的是,没有任何证据支持这些主张。我们并非缺乏所需技能;我们缺乏的是政策决心。正如我所说,结构性失业不是一个真正的问题,而是一个借口——在迫切需要行动的时候,不对美国问题采取行动的理由。
